Nike: net profits up 12% in 2nd quarter

(CercleFinance.com) - On Friday evening, Nike published an increase in net profits of 12% to 1.
3 billion dollars for its second quarter 2020-21, representing 78 cents per share, an EPS considerably outstripping analysts' average estimates.

The sportswear giant has seen a 0.9 point downgrade in its gross margins to 43.1%, with more intense promotional activities and restructuring costs, but its revenues increased 9% to 11.2 billion dollars (+7% excluding exchange differences).

“During the quarter, we experienced temporary door closures in geographies affected by rising COVID-19 cases; however, more than 90% of our owned stores are open today, with some operating on reduced hours” the group specified.
